Borys Kolesnikov to Be in Charge of Interdenominational and Interethnic Relations in Ukrainian Government

27.07.2010, 10:38

The government of Ukraine redistributed the powers of the dismissed Vice Prime Minister Volodymyr Semynozhenko.

The government of Ukraine redistributed the powers of the dismissed Vice Prime Minister Volodymyr Semynozhenko, reports proUA.

The text of the respective document was posted by the government’s website on Monday.

In particular, Vice Prime Minister Borys Kolesnikov will now be responsible for questions of advertisement, exhibitions, interdenominational and interethnic relations, culture, protection of cultural heritage, social morality and state language policy.
